HB 2228: appropriation; Ganado School Loop Road
Sponsor: Representative Teller, LD 7
Committee on Transportation
Overview
Appropriates $908,300 from the GF in FY 2022 to the Arizona Department of Transportation (ADOT) to distribute to Apache County for the construction repairs and upgrades of County Road C-420 Ganado School Loop Road.
History
The county board of supervisors (BOS) is allowed to spend public monies for maintenance of public roads and streets other than legally designated state and county highways located outside the limits of an incorporated city or town (A.R.S. § 28-6705). The BOS is allowed to levy a real and personal property tax of not more than .25 cents per $100 of property in the county for road purposes (A.R.S. § 28-6712). If approved by the voters at a countywide election, a county may also levy and collect a transportation excise tax not exceeding 10 percent of the state transaction privilege tax rate (A.R.S. § 42-6107).
Provisions
1. Appropriates $908,300 from the GF in FY
2022 to ADOT to distribute to Apache County for the construction repairs and
upgrades of County Road C-420 Ganado School Loop Road (Sec. 1).
